Often misattributed to Thomas Edison
Famous lines widely pinned on Thomas Edison that we’ve traced to someone else.
“I am much less interested in what is called God's word than in God's deeds”
actually John Burroughs
“There is no expedient to which a man will not go to avoid the labor of thinking”
actually Sir Joshua Reynolds
“When you've exhausted all possibilities, remember this: you haven't”
actually Robert H. Schuller
